Weather & Climate in Bouan Houyé, Ivory Coast

Temperature, precipitation, air quality, natural hazards, and monthly weather data.

Bouan Houyé has a warm climate with an average annual temperature of 76°F (24°C). Winters average 76°F in January while summers reach 74°F in July / relatively mild seasonal variation. The area gets 203 sunny days per year. Annual precipitation totals 73.7 inches (wetter than the 38-inch national average). The city sits at an elevation of 1,293 feet.

Monthly Weather

Month Avg Temperature Precipitation Summary
January 76°F (24°C) 0.6 in Driest
February 77°F (25°C) 1.8 in
March 77°F (25°C) 4.1 in
April 78°F (25°C) 5.7 in Warmest
May 77°F (25°C) 6.1 in
June 75°F (24°C) 9.5 in
July 74°F (23°C) 10.5 in
August 73°F (23°C) 12.5 in Coldest
September 76°F (24°C) 13.1 in Wettest
October 76°F (25°C) 6.7 in
November 76°F (24°C) 2.4 in
December 74°F (24°C) 0.9 in

Bouan Houyé has a seasonal temperature swing of 4°F / from 73°F in August to 78°F in April. Total annual precipitation is 73.7 inches, with September being the wettest month (13.1") and January the driest (0.6").
